I want to export my report to a PDF including pictures from URL. The pictures are shown in the report (picute below) but are not in the exported PDF file.
I attached two photo's. One of the view within PBI online report and one from the exported PDF FileExported PDF file
PowerBI Report view
Does anyone know how to solve this?

Based on the information you provided, I did a simple test and the images in the PDF display properly.
If the images require authentication or have access restrictions, they may not render in the exported PDF. Please make sure the image URLs are publicly accessible.
Sometimes browser or network settings may interfere with image rendering. Try using a different browser or exporting the PDF from a different network to eliminate these factors.

This was indeed the problem. I tried using a photo from internet and it worked.
